Steering Column
REMOVAL
- Disconnect and isolate the negative battery cable. If equipped with an Intelligent Battery Sensor (IBS), disconnect the IBS connector first before disconnecting the negative battery cable.
- Remove the gap hider. Refer to GAP HIDER, STEERING COLUMN SHROUD, RE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ION .
- Remove the lower steering column pinch bolt DISCARD pinch bolt.
Do not start to remove (or break free) Pinch Bolt with an impact wrench/gun.
1 - Lower Steering Column Pinch Bolt 2 - Dash Panel Bolt - Remove the wire retainer from the steering column.
1 - Steering Column Nuts 2 - Wire Retainer - Remove the steering column nuts.
- Remove the steering column assembly.
INSTALLATION
Follow the removal procedure in reverse for general reassembly of the components on the vehicle. The steps listed below are calling out specific procedures that should be followed during installation.
- Position the steering column in the vehicle. Install the steering column nuts and tighten to the proper torque specifications. Refer to T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S .
- Connect the steering column to the steering gear. The hole in steering column must align with whistle notch in the steering gear. Hand start a NEW pinch bolt and tighten to the proper torque specifications. Refer to T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S .
